Housing Material Deep Dive: Aluminum vs. Solid Iron/Composite

The material useful for the h2o pump housing is arguably the most important differentiator, influencing weight, heat transfer, corrosion resistance, and manufacturing strategies.

pounds and Thermal Conductivity:

oFREY (Aluminum Alloy): Aluminum's primary gain is its considerably decrease density compared to cast iron. This translates directly to bodyweight personal savings – a little but cumulative benefit for overall auto body weight, potentially contributing to marginal gasoline economic system enhancements and somewhat superior dealing with dynamics. far more critically, aluminum boasts top-quality thermal conductivity. This implies the FREY pump housing itself can dissipate heat more successfully and speedily transfer warmth in the motor block into the coolant, aiding the cooling process's Total efficiency, Primarily all through high-load Procedure or in very hot climates.

oRM European (Solid Iron/Composite): Cast iron is significantly heavier, introducing far more mass for the engine assembly. whilst strong, its thermal conductivity is reduce than aluminum's, which means the housing itself contributes less to heat dissipation. Composite housings offer a middle floor, lighter than iron but potentially less conductive than aluminum, though supplying good corrosion resistance and style overall flexibility. Cast iron's mass, on the other hand, does lend it inherent vibration damping properties.

Corrosion and exhaustion Resistance:

oFREY (Aluminum Alloy): Aluminum Normally types a passive oxide layer (aluminum oxide) on exposure to air, providing inherent corrosion resistance. nonetheless, aluminum alloys might be at risk of pitting corrosion or galvanic corrosion (if improperly mounted with dissimilar metals with out ideal coolant inhibitors) in excess of extended durations, particularly when coolant top quality degrades. To combat this, superior-high quality aluminum pumps like FREY's often integrate protective surface treatments (reviewed afterwards). Aluminum frequently displays excellent fatigue resistance less than regular running stresses.

oRM European (Solid Iron/Composite): Cast iron's Most important vulnerability is rust (iron oxide) if the coolant's anti-corrosion additives are depleted or the wrong coolant style is employed. suitable cooling procedure upkeep is very important. nevertheless, Forged iron is highly immune to impression and abrasion, which makes it very tough physically. Its tiredness existence is usually exceptional below typical disorders. Composite housings are inherently proof against rust and a lot of types of chemical corrosion found in cooling devices, providing a resilient option, Whilst their extended-term resistance to heat cycling and probable brittleness in comparison with metallic demands thought.

Manufacturing method and layout:

oFREY (Aluminum Alloy): Aluminum alloys are well-suited for contemporary die-casting procedures. This permits to the creation of sophisticated inner flow passages and thin-walled structures with superior precision. This precision can improve coolant move dynamics within the pump, probably increasing hydraulic efficiency and contributing to better All round cooling general performance.

oRM European (Forged Iron/Composite): Cast iron housings are typically developed using sand casting, a mature and cost-powerful process suitable for large-volume generation. While capable of manufacturing complex styles, it may well present somewhat considerably less precision in intricate internal specifics in comparison with die-casting aluminum. Composite housings will often be injection molded, allowing for significant design freedom and most likely lessen manufacturing expenditures than casting metal.

Sealing technological innovation: The Leak Prevention Battleground

The seal may be the h2o pump's Achilles' heel. blocking coolant leaks is paramount, and sealing engineering has advanced appreciably.

The Evolution of Seals: Early h2o pumps relied on easy packing or essential lip seals. Later, paper or cork gaskets ended up typical for sealing the pump housing for the motor block. fashionable styles predominantly use refined mechanical face seals combined with elastomeric O-rings or bellows.

floor therapies and Corrosion defense

further than the base materials, floor therapies play a significant position in longevity, specifically for aluminum housings.

FREY (Anodizing): FREY highlights using anodizing for its aluminum housings. Anodizing electrochemically converts the aluminum surface area into a layer of strong, challenging, corrosion-resistant aluminum oxide. This layer is integral to your metal (not only a coating) and offers:

oExcellent protection against oxidation and chemical assault from coolant.

oIncreased surface area hardness, offering some use resistance.

oA clean, environmentally friendly procedure in comparison with some paints.

RM European (Paint/Coatings or pure Finish): Solid iron pumps are often painted (e.g., with epoxy paint) to avoid external rust and supply a concluded visual appearance. when powerful initially, paint layers can chip or peel eventually on account of warmth, vibration, or impacts, most likely exposing the fundamental iron to corrosion In the event the coolant inhibitors fall short. Composite pumps typically call for no more corrosion safety. Some substantial-conclusion pumps across the market (referenced by Wikipedia about typical technological know-how) may possibly use specialized coatings like phosphate conversion coatings or perhaps abradable powder coatings on inner surfaces to optimize clearances and increase effectiveness, however this is often reserved for top quality applications.
